About

Private Garden on Brownstone Block - Prewar 2 Bedroom and 1.5 bath home with washer/dryer.

This south-facing space is accented with an exposed white brick wall and with bamboo wood floors. In the center is the large, renovated, and open chef's kitchen with all new appliances. The sleek cobalt countertops provide ample workspace, and the wood cabinetry provide plenty of storage.

About Upper West Side

Sandwiched between two beautiful parks, the Upper West Side is one of the greenest spots in Manhattan. For that reason, it is a perennial favorite. The Upper West Side is relaxed, but never dull. There are plenty of low-key bars and restaurants to frequent along Amsterdam Avenue, and Broadway is an always-bustling commercial center. The wide, tree-lined streets still boast many mom-and-pop stores. Less posh than the Upper East Side, it is more easily accessible by public transportation, and real estate prices are just as, if not more, expensive.
